failed to allocate for range 0: no IP addresses available in range set: 172.20.xx.1-172.20.xx.254
今天遇到一个机器上的Pod 在创建以后一直处于Init 0/1的状态,进到这个节点查看其kubelet的状态,发现果然有问题
systemctl status kubelet
.go:] Container "1a7183767162740ba734e2c4b880e2937af1680e15fb1a7d66dc7e48fe0ca68c" not found in pod's containers
RunPodSandbox from runtime service failed: rpc error: code = Unknown desc = NetworkPlugin cni failed to set up pod "ts-train-mongo-7f6f6668bd-rn2n4_default" network: failed to allocate f
o:] CreatePodSandbox for pod "ts-train-mongo-7f6f6668bd-rn2n4_default(1264e4b7-fd27-11e8-aa60-525400c4f9f5)" failed: rpc error: code = Unknown desc = NetworkPlugin cni failed to set up
o:] createPodSandbox for pod "ts-train-mongo-7f6f6668bd-rn2n4_default(1264e4b7-fd27-11e8-aa60-525400c4f9f5)" failed: rpc error: code = Unknown desc = NetworkPlugin cni failed to set up
rror syncing pod 1264e4b7-fd27-11e8-aa60-525400c4f9f5 ("ts-train-mongo-7f6f6668bd-rn2n4_default(1264e4b7-fd27-11e8-aa60-525400c4f9f5)"), skipping: failed to "CreatePodSandbox" for "ts-tra
o:] No ready sandbox for pod "ts-order-other-service-78d5ff8b57-2k6gf_default(830f4782-fd27-11e8-aa60-525400c4f9f5)" can be found. Need to start a new one
o:] No ready sandbox for pod "ts-station-service-c9ff7c7b7-pkpt9_default(9a9c5010-fd27-11e8-aa60-525400c4f9f5)" can be found. Need to start a new one
o:] No ready sandbox for pod "ts-preserve-service-7b95474f77-8l4jw_default(88bc030d-fd27-11e8-aa60-525400c4f9f5)" can be found. Need to start a new one
ing network: failed to allocate for range : no IP addresses available in range set: 172.20.5.1-172.20.5.254
le adding to cni network: failed to allocate for range : no IP addresses available in range set: 172.20.5.1-172.20.5.254
提示200多个IP都被用完了,这什么情况
/var/lib/cni/networks/cbr0# ls
172.20.5.10 172.20.5.118 172.20.5.136 172.20.5.154 172.20.5.172 172.20.5.190 172.20.5.208 172.20.5.226 172.20.5.244 172.20.5.33 172.20.5.51 172.20.5.7 172.20.5.88
172.20.5.100 172.20.5.119 172.20.5.137 172.20.5.155 172.20.5.173 172.20.5.191 172.20.5.209 172.20.5.227 172.20.5.245 172.20.5.34 172.20.5.52 172.20.5.70 172.20.5.89
172.20.5.101 172.20.5.12 172.20.5.138 172.20.5.156 172.20.5.174 172.20.5.192 172.20.5.21 172.20.5.228 172.20.5.246 172.20.5.35 172.20.5.53 172.20.5.71 172.20.5.9
172.20.5.102 172.20.5.120 172.20.5.139 172.20.5.157 172.20.5.175 172.20.5.193 172.20.5.210 172.20.5.229 172.20.5.247 172.20.5.36 172.20.5.54 172.20.5.72 172.20.5.90
172.20.5.103 172.20.5.121 172.20.5.14 172.20.5.158 172.20.5.176 172.20.5.194 172.20.5.211 172.20.5.23 172.20.5.248 172.20.5.37 172.20.5.55 172.20.5.73 172.20.5.91
172.20.5.104 172.20.5.122 172.20.5.140 172.20.5.159 172.20.5.177 172.20.5.195 172.20.5.212 172.20.5.230 172.20.5.249 172.20.5.38 172.20.5.56 172.20.5.74 172.20.5.92
172.20.5.105 172.20.5.123 172.20.5.141 172.20.5.16 172.20.5.178 172.20.5.196 172.20.5.213 172.20.5.231 172.20.5.25 172.20.5.39 172.20.5.57 172.20.5.75 172.20.5.93
172.20.5.106 172.20.5.124 172.20.5.142 172.20.5.160 172.20.5.179 172.20.5.197 172.20.5.214 172.20.5.232 172.20.5.250 172.20.5.4 172.20.5.58 172.20.5.76 172.20.5.94
172.20.5.107 172.20.5.125 172.20.5.143 172.20.5.161 172.20.5.18 172.20.5.198 172.20.5.215 172.20.5.233 172.20.5.251 172.20.5.40 172.20.5.59 172.20.5.77 172.20.5.95
172.20.5.108 172.20.5.126 172.20.5.144 172.20.5.162 172.20.5.180 172.20.5.199 172.20.5.216 172.20.5.234 172.20.5.252 172.20.5.41 172.20.5.6 172.20.5.78 172.20.5.96
172.20.5.109 172.20.5.127 172.20.5.145 172.20.5.163 172.20.5.181 172.20.5.2 172.20.5.217 172.20.5.235 172.20.5.253 172.20.5.42 172.20.5.60 172.20.5.79 172.20.5.97
172.20.5.11 172.20.5.128 172.20.5.146 172.20.5.164 172.20.5.182 172.20.5.20 172.20.5.218 172.20.5.236 172.20.5.254 172.20.5.43 172.20.5.61 172.20.5.8 172.20.5.98
172.20.5.110 172.20.5.129 172.20.5.147 172.20.5.165 172.20.5.183 172.20.5.200 172.20.5.219 172.20.5.237 172.20.5.26 172.20.5.44 172.20.5.62 172.20.5.80 172.20.5.99
172.20.5.111 172.20.5.13 172.20.5.148 172.20.5.166 172.20.5.184 172.20.5.201 172.20.5.22 172.20.5.238 172.20.5.27 172.20.5.45 172.20.5.63 172.20.5.81 172.20.6.197
172.20.5.112 172.20.5.130 172.20.5.149 172.20.5.167 172.20.5.185 172.20.5.202 172.20.5.220 172.20.5.239 172.20.5.28 172.20.5.46 172.20.5.64 172.20.5.82 last_reserved_ip.
172.20.5.113 172.20.5.131 172.20.5.15 172.20.5.168 172.20.5.186 172.20.5.203 172.20.5.221 172.20.5.24 172.20.5.29 172.20.5.47 172.20.5.65 172.20.5.83 lock
172.20.5.114 172.20.5.132 172.20.5.150 172.20.5.169 172.20.5.187 172.20.5.204 172.20.5.222 172.20.5.240 172.20.5.3 172.20.5.48 172.20.5.66 172.20.5.84
172.20.5.115 172.20.5.133 172.20.5.151 172.20.5.17 172.20.5.188 172.20.5.205 172.20.5.223 172.20.5.241 172.20.5.30 172.20.5.49 172.20.5.67 172.20.5.85
172.20.5.116 172.20.5.134 172.20.5.152 172.20.5.170 172.20.5.189 172.20.5.206 172.20.5.224 172.20.5.242 172.20.5.31 172.20.5.5 172.20.5.68 172.20.5.86
172.20.5.117 172.20.5.135 172.20.5.153 172.20.5.171 172.20.5.19 172.20.5.207 172.20.5.225 172.20.5.243 172.20.5.32 172.20.5.50 172.20.5.69 172.20.5.87
##flannel创建了很多文件
/var/lib/cni/flannel# ls | wc ; date
解决方案
rm -rf /var/lib/cni/flannel/* && rm -rf /var/lib/cni/networks/cbr0/* && ip link delete cni0
rm -rf /var/lib/cni/networks/cni0/*
failed to allocate for range 0: no IP addresses available in range set: 172.20.xx.1-172.20.xx.254的更多相关文章
- "cni0" already has an IP address different from 10.244.2.1/24。 Error while adding to cni network: failed to allocate for range 0: no IP addresses available in range set: 10.244.2.1-10.244.2.254
"cni0" already has an IP address different from 10.244.2.1/24. Error while adding to cni n ...
- Android ADT中增大AVD内存后无法启动:emulator failed to allocate memory 8 (转)
Android ADT中增大AVD内存后无法启动:emulator failed to allocate memory 8http://www.crifan.com/android_emulator_ ...
- 03_已解决 [salt.master :2195][ERROR ][6219] Failed to allocate a jid. The requested returner 'mysql' could not be loaded.
总结: 对于python2.7环境下的salt来说,要安装pip install mysql-python 对于python3环境下的salt来说,pip install mysqlclient的时候 ...
- Android 启动模拟器是出现“Failed to allocate memory: 8”错误提示的原因及解决办法
某天,Android 启动模拟器是出现“Failed to allocate memory: 8”错误,模拟器无法启动,如下图: 原因:设置了不正确AVD显示屏模式,4.0版默认的模式为WVGA800 ...
- Failed to allocate the network(s), not rescheduling
Failed to allocate the network(s), not rescheduling 在计算节点的/etc/nova/nova.conf中添加下面两句 #Fail instance ...
- 关于阿里云ESC上go语言项目编译6l: running gcc failed: Cannot allocate memory
(1)前段时间将自己的阿里云服务器上的系统由centos 6.5换为了ubuntu 14,其他的硬件配置都没有发生改变,将服务器上的数据恢复并且重新安装了golang的编译环境后,发现使用go bui ...
- Asterisk 11 chan_sip.c: Failed to authenticate device 看不到IP的问题
Asterisk 11 chan_sip.c: Failed to authenticate device 看不到IP的问题 没有验证过 原文地址 http://www.coochey.net/? ...
- zabbix-Get value from agent failed: cannot connect to [[127.0.0.1]:10050]: [111] Connection refused
监控zabbix服务端这台服务器,然后显示Get value from agent failed: cannot connect to [[127.0.0.1]:10050]: [111] Conne ...
- fork failed.: Cannot allocate memory
在做压力测试时候: [root@666 ok]# webbench -c 5000 -t30 http://10.100.0.61/ Webbench - Simple Web Benchmark 1 ...
随机推荐
- encryptjs 加密 前端数据(vue 使用 RSA加密、java 后端 RSA解密)
1.index.html引入 <script src="./static/js/jsencrypt.min.js"></script> 或者 npm i j ...
- userBean之设置属性
package com.java.model; public class Student { private String name;private int age; public String ge ...
- 洛谷 P2323 [HNOI2006]公路修建问题
题目描述 输入输出格式 输入格式: 在实际评测时,将只会有m-1行公路 输出格式: 输入输出样例 输入样例#1: 4 2 5 1 2 6 5 1 3 3 1 2 3 9 4 2 4 6 1 3 4 4 ...
- python基础教程总结15——7 自定义电子公告板
1. Python进行SQLite数据库操作 简单的介绍 SQLite数据库是一款非常小巧的嵌入式开源数据库软件,也就是说没有独立的维护进程,所有的维护都来自于程序本身.它是遵守ACID的关联式数据库 ...
- vue validate多表单验证思考 之前写过一个里外层,现在觉得不合适,应该平行的写,然后都给ret,最后判断ret 再做出反应,这样整体表单的所有验证就都报验证,然后最后提交的时候把组件内的对象合并到总的对象,再提交
vue validate多表单验证思考 之前写过一个里外层,现在觉得不合适,应该平行的写,然后都给ret,最后判断ret 再做出反应,这样整体表单的所有验证就都报验证,然后最后提交的时候把组件内的对象 ...
- nginx 的反向代理及缓存功能
上游服务器的设置 server { #监听的IP及端口 listen 127.0.0.1:8080; #虚拟主机对硬解析的主机名 #server_name localhost; #charset ko ...
- js类型判别大合集
1.typeof number,string,boolean,undefined,symbol,object,function 对象中除了函数为function,其他对象都判别为object, 缺陷: ...
- Python中文编码问题(字符串前面加'u')
中文编码问题是用中文的程序员经常头大的问题,在python下也是如此,那么应该怎么理解和解决python的编码问题呢? 我们要知道python内部使用的是unicode编码,而外部却要面对千奇百怪的各 ...
- MySQL数据库主从切换脚本自动化
MySQL数据库主从切换脚本自动化 本文转载自:https://blog.csdn.net/weixin_36135773/article/details/79514507 在一些实际环境中,如何实现 ...
- vue $emit子组件传出多个参数,如何在父组件中在接收所有参数的同时添加自定义参数
Vue.js 父子组件通信的十种方式 前言 很多时候用$emit携带参数传出事件,并且又需要在父组件中使用自定义参数时,这时我们就无法接受到子组件传出的参数了.找到了两种方法可以同时添加自定义参数的方 ...